Can Sea breezes occur at night?

Can Sea breezes occur at night? The opposite of a sea breeze is a land breeze. While sea breezes occur during the day, land breezes occur at night. Do valley breezes occur at night? Which generator is used in industry?

Which generator is used in industry? Industrial applications normally call for three phase power generation or 480 volts. Generators for multiple requirements include those that provide 120 – 208 volt service and 277 – 480 volt service. Are examples of elastic body?

Are examples of elastic body? There is no perfectly elastic body but quartz fibre and Phosphor bronze are examples of near perfect elastic bodies.
